Popular Defense MythsWhat are the frequent false beliefs about the responsibilities of a criminal defense counsel? Many individuals believe that defense lawyers mainly seek to free clients who are guilty, painting them as heroes of the unjust. In fact, their role is to make sure that legal rights are defended and each client receives a just hearing, regardless of guilt or innocence. Another frequent misunderstanding is that being a defense lawyer is simple, often neglecting the in-depth study and preparation needed. Furthermore, some assume that all cases are resolved successfully through spectacular trials, while the majority are concluded by agreements. Understanding these false beliefs is crucial to understand the complicated and vital role that defense attorneys hold in the justice system.Proven Legal Tactics Broken DownCriminal defense lawyers utilize a range of legal tactics, each tailored to the details of a case and the proof at hand. One common false belief is that lawyers always aim for dismissal; in reality, they often broker plea deals or attempt to reduce sentences. Another myth is that all defenses rely on proving innocence; however, many focus on demonstrating reasonable doubt. Defense lawyers may also utilize pretrial motions to suppress unlawfully obtained evidence. They understand jury psychology, creating narratives that appeal to jurors. Additionally, lawyers often collaborate with expert witnesses to challenge prosecution claims. This partnership ultimately bolsters the defense and enhances the likelihood of a favorable legal resolution.Often Asked QuestionsWhat Do You Usually Pay When Engaging a Criminal Defense Lawyer?Hiring a criminal defense attorney typically runs between $2,500 and $10,000, depending on the intricacy of the case and the attorney's experience. Extra fees may arise for court appearances and other legal work.Am I Permitted to defend Myself in a Penal Case?Certainly, individuals can represent themselves in a criminal case, a choice known as "pro se" representation. However, it is typically unwise due to the complexities of law and possible outcomes, making expert counsel advisable.What Items Should I Bring to My Initial Consultation With a Attorney?During your first meeting with a legal professional, you should compile relevant documents, including identification, any legal notices, prior court records, a compilation of questions, and a case overview to facilitate meaningful conversation.What is the typical timeline for a criminal defense case?A criminal law case usually requires anywhere from several months to several years, depending on numerous considerations such as complexity, court schedules, and negotiation procedures. Each case is individual, influencing the complete timeline substantially. What Are the Anticipated Results of My Case?Potential results in a criminal defense case encompass exoneration, negotiated settlement, reduced charges, or conviction. Every situation is based on proof, courtroom tactics, and trial circumstances, impacting the defendant's future significantly.
